The LG 27U730SA-W is a 27-inch 4K smart monitor that combines a high-color-gamut IPS panel with webOS streaming apps and a 65 W USB-C dock. It offers strong ergonomics but is limited by a 60 Hz panel and reliance on a remote control.

Meta Portal is a 10-inch smart video-calling hub with a touchscreen, AI camera tracking and Alexa integration. It excels at hands-free family calls but is tethered to power and tied to the Facebook ecosystem.

Professional reviewers lauded the Portal's AI-driven camera and audio quality, calling it one of the most seamless video-calling devices, but noted privacy concerns and a limited app ecosystem.
Everyday users appreciate the easy video calls and family-friendly features, though many complain about the mandatory Facebook account and the need to keep the device plugged in.

Professional reviewers view it as a pioneering smart monitor that bridges the gap between traditional displays and smart TVs, praising its 4K IPS panel and AI-driven Dynamic Tone Mapping while noting the lack of variable refresh rate and 60 Hz limitation for gamers.
Everyday users love its standalone entertainment capabilities and USB-C convenience, but complain about the remote control necessity, occasional webOS sluggishness, and average built-in speakers.
